Community Alert: PSO Recognized as 2022 FASRO Agency of the Year

PSO Honored by Florida Association of School Resource Officers as Agency of the Year, Lt. Earns Lifetime Achievement Honor

Pasco Sheriff’s Office was honored to be named the 2022 Agency of the Year by the Florida Association of School Resource Officers (FASRO). The honor was presented yesterday during FASRO’s annual conference, held in Orlando. PSO thanks FASRO for recognizing the impact our SROs have on the lives of Pasco’s students each day, and for recognizing PSO’s commitment to ensuring schools are a safe place for all.

PSO SRO Lt. Troy Fergueson was also presented with a Lifetime Achievement Award at this year’s FASRO conference. Congratulations to Lt. Fergueson on earning this incredible honor, and thank you for your dedicated work to the safety of Pasco’s students.

Last year, FASRO also honored Cpl. Elders, SRO at Pine View Middle School in Land O’ Lakes, as the 2021 SRO of the Year.

PSO is incredibly proud to be recognized for our innovative approach and exceptional commitment to school safety which keeps students, faculty, staff and families safe in the communities we serve.
